What's Happening?
Arsenal is actively pursuing the transfers of Vinicius Junior from Real Madrid and Bruno Guimaraes from Newcastle United. The club believes that acquiring these players will significantly enhance their competitive and commercial prospects. Vinicius Jr's
potential move is seen as financially beneficial for the player, with improved image rights shares. Arsenal is optimistic about securing his transfer, although the final decision rests with the player. Meanwhile, talks for Guimaraes are progressing, with Arsenal expected to make an offer in the region of £80 million, including add-ons.

What's Next?
The coming days are crucial as Arsenal awaits decisions from Vinicius Jr and Real Madrid. If the player opts not to renew his contract, Arsenal is well-positioned to finalize the transfer. For Guimaraes, Arsenal is close to reaching an agreement through intermediaries, with a formal offer expected soon.
